Start your morning by visiting the majestic City Palace, which offers breathtaking views of Lake Pichola. Afterward, explore the serene Saheliyon-ki-Bari garden, known for its beautiful fountains and marble elephants. In the afternoon, take a boat ride on Lake Pichola to experience the tranquil waters and visit Jag Mandir Palace. In the evening, witness a cultural performance at Bagore Ki Haveli followed by a stroll along the famous Fateh Sagar Lake.
Begin your day with a visit to the magnificent Amber Fort, where you can explore the stunning architecture and enjoy an elephant ride. Afterward, head to the City Palace and its museum to delve into the history and culture of Jaipur. In the afternoon, explore the Hawa Mahal, also known as the Palace of Winds, and marvel at its intricate facade. End your day with a visit to the vibrant bazaars of Jaipur, such as Johri Bazaar and Bapu Bazaar.
Start your day exploring the magnificent Jaisalmer Fort, also known as the Golden Fort, which stands tall amidst the golden sands. Visit the Jain Temples within the fort complex, showcasing intricate architecture and carvings. Afterward, explore the Patwon Ki Haveli, a cluster of five grand havelis with exquisite artwork. In the afternoon, enjoy a camel safari in the Thar Desert and witness a mesmerizing sunset. Wrap up your day with a cultural dance and music performance at a desert camp.
Spend your morning visiting the Gadisar Lake, a serene oasis that offers a calm respite from the desert surroundings. Explore the beautiful temples and ghats surrounding the lake. In the afternoon, discover the exquisite craftsmanship at the Silk Route Art Gallery and shop for unique souvenirs. Witness a stunning puppet show at the Desert Cultural Centre in the evening.
Head back to Jaipur and spend your morning exploring the Albert Hall Museum, which houses a unique collection of artifacts and exhibits. Afterward, visit the Birla Mandir, a stunning temple made of white marble. In the afternoon, indulge in some retail therapy at the famous Jaipur markets, such as Tripolia Bazaar and Chandpole Bazaar. Finally, catch a mesmerizing sunset from the Nahargarh Fort and enjoy panoramic views of Jaipur.
